A study conducted by OMICRON reveals critical cybersecurity shortcomings in the Operational Technology (OT) networks of over 100 energy facilities worldwide, including substations, power plants, and control centers. The findings highlight recurring technical, organizational, and functional issues that leave these infrastructures vulnerable to cyber threats.
